Instructions

  1. Step 1: Heat 2 tablespoons ol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ering. Season 1 pound pork tenderloin medallions with 1 teaspoon salt and 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, then add to the pan in a single layer. Sear for 3 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through. Remove pork and keep warm.
  2. Step 2: Reduce heat to medium. Add 2 tablespoons unsalted butter and 3 minced garlic cloves to the pan, sauté for 1 minute until fragrant but not browned. Stir in 1 teaspoon chopped fresh rosemary and 1 teaspoon chopped fresh thyme, cooking for 30 seconds.
  3. Step 3: Pour in 1/3 cup dry white wine and simmer for 2 minutes, scraping up browned bits. Add 1/2 cup chicken broth and continue simmering for 3-4 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the back of a spoon.
  4. Step 4: Return pork medallions to the pan and spoon sauce over them to reheat for 1 minute. Serve immediately garnished with extra fresh herbs if desired.

How do I store leftover Pan-Roasted Pork Medallions with Herb Pan Sauce?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ep pork tenderloin from drying out.

How do I scale Pan-Roasted Pork Medallions with Herb Pan Sauce for a different number of people?

The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
